Description of the project

The project CRIS – Combating crisis situations by innovative STEM tools and entrepreneurship skills addresses secondary school teachers, with the aim of improving their digital/ICT literacy and entrepreneurial skills and equipping them with tools to motivate and inspire students aged 11-14.

In the preparation of the project, 3 key themes were contemplated to be explored to raise awareness on this topic: crisis management, entrepreneurial mindset and innovative STEM tools, namely Augmented and Virtual Reality (AR/VR) and 3D printing.

Activities

  • Theoretical research at local and European level on the topics of crisis management, growth mindset and AR/VR and 3D printing within school curricula.
  • Elaboration and proposal of questionnaires to teachers about crisis management, entrepreneurial mindset and innovative STEM tools, i.e. augmented and virtual reality (AR/VR) and 3D printing.
  • Training of teachers on the project topics.
  • Piloting and pupils contest on innovative ideas.

Results

  • Curriculum and handbook for teachers on crisis management, growth mindset, and AR/VR and 3D printing: a guiding material for students aimed at learning about crisis management, entrepreneurship and growth mindset, augmented and virtual reality and 3D printing technologies.
  • Toolkit for teachers: 3 guides will be developed focusing on topics such as crisis management, entrepreneurship and growth mindset and augmented and virtual reality and 3D printing technologies. Booklet for redesigning existing lesson plans using augmented and virtual reality and 3D printing technologies will be prepared together with instructional videos.
  • Web platform and e-learning modules: a web platform being specifically designed offering all functionalities to use developed materials as distance learning or in-class resources.
  • Award framework: an award framework will be developed to be able to select schools on a national level through online, virtual competitions.
